| E8-30537 | Amendment to Standards and Practices for All Appropriate Inquiries Under CERCLA | Proposed Rule | EPA is proposing to amend the Standards and Practices for All Appropriate Inquiries to reference a standard practice recently made available by ASTM International, a widely recognized standards development organization. Specifically, EPA is proposing to amend the All Appropriate Inquiries Final Rule to reference ASTM International's E2247-08 "Standard Practice for Environmental Site Assessments: Phase I Environmental Site Assessment Process for Forestland or Rural Property" and allow for its use to satisfy the statutory requirements for conducting all appropriate inquiries under the Comprehensive Environmental Response, Compensation and Liability Act (CERCLA). In the "Rules and Regulations" section of this Federal Register, EPA is amending the All Appropriate Inquiries Final Rule to reference the ASTM E2247-08 Standard as a direct final rule without a prior proposed rule. If we receive no adverse comment, we will not take further action on this proposed rule. | 2008-12-23 | 2008 | 12 | https://www.federalregister.gov/documents/2008/12/23/E8-30537/amendment-to-standards-and-practices-for-all-appropriate-inquiries-under-cercla | https://www.govinfo.gov/content/pkg/FR-2008-12-23/pdf/E8-30537.pdf | Environmental Protection Agency | 145 | EPA is proposing to amend the Standards and Practices for All Appropriate Inquiries to reference a standard practice recently made available by ASTM International, a widely recognized standards development organization.
